Intellisense do not work in dynamic type. It is resolved at Runtime. Dynamic type work for static types as well as anonymous types.
If intellisense would have worked, it would have defied the very purpose of dynamicity.
I think you should read Jon Skeet answer about object vs dynamic
here
与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…